Learn how to Find a Reliable HVAC Contractor in Your Area

65

Finding a reliable HVAC (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ning) contractor is crucial for making certain the comfort and safety of your home. Whether you need installation, upkeep, or repairs, choosing the fitting professional can make a significant distinction in the quality of the service and the longevity of your HVAC system. Here’s a complete guide that can assist you discover a relyable HVAC contractor in your area.

1. Start with Research

Begin by researching local HVAC contractors. Use search engines like google and yahoo, online directories, and review sites like Yelp, Google Evaluations, and Angie’s List to compile a list of potential contractors. Pay attention to scores and read buyer opinions to get a way of each firm’s reputation. Additionally, check their websites to study their services, experience, and any specializations they may have.

2. Check Credentials

Ensure that the HVAC contractors you consider are licensed, insured, and certified. Licensing requirements fluctuate by state, but a legitimate contractor should be able to provide proof of their license. Insurance is equally important, as it protects you in case of accidents or damages throughout the job. Certifications from organizations like North American Technician Excellence (NATE) point out that the technicians have met rigorous trade standards.

3. Ask for Recommendations

Word of mouth is a robust tool. Ask friends, family, neighbors, or colleagues if they’ve any recommendations based on their experiences. Personal referrals can provide valuable insights into the quality of service, reliability, and professionalism of a contractor.

4. Consider Expertise and Experience

Expertise issues in the HVAC industry. Contractors with a long history in the business are more likely to have encountered a wide range of issues and may supply efficient solutions. Inquire concerning the contractor’s experience with the precise HVAC system in your home. Some systems, such as ductless mini-splits or geothermal units, require specialised knowledge.

5. Request Detailed Estimates

Contact a few selected contractors and request written estimates. A reliable contractor will visit your private home to evaluate your HVAC needs before providing a quote. Be wary of contractors who provide estimates over the phone without a site visit. The estimate should include a breakdown of prices, including labor, materials, and any additional fees. Examine the estimates to determine which offers the very best worth for the services provided.

6. Check References

Ask the contractor for a list of references and take the time to contact them. Speaking with earlier purchasers can give you an thought of the contractor’s reliability, punctuality, and quality of work. Ask about their total satisfaction, any points encountered, and the way the contractor handled them.

7. Inquire About Maintenance Plans

Regular upkeep is essential for keeping your HVAC system running efficiently. Ask potential contractors if they offer maintenance plans. A good upkeep plan may also help forestall expensive repairs and prolong the lifetime of your system. Contractors who offer such plans are often more invested in making certain your system operates smoothly.

8. Consider Communication and Professionalism

Pay attention to how the contractor communicates with you. Are they attentive to your inquiries? Do they explain technical details in a way you may understand? Professionalism and good communication are indicators of a contractor’s reliability and commitment to buyer service.

9. Confirm Energy Efficiency Knowledge

Energy efficiency is a key consideration in modern HVAC systems. A reliable contractor should be knowledgeable about energy-efficient technologies and practices. They should be able to recommend systems and options that may aid you save on energy costs while sustaining comfort in your home.

10. Understand Warranties and Guarantees

Finally, inquire about warranties and guarantees. Reliable contractors stand behind their work and the products they install. Make sure you understand the terms of any warranties on equipment and guarantees on labor. This can provide peace of mind and protect you from future issues.

Conclusion

Discovering a reliable HVAC contractor requires careful research and consideration. By following these steps, you’ll be able to establish a contractor who’s experienced, professional, and trustworthy. Taking the time to decide on the proper HVAC professional will ensure your system is installed or serviced correctly, providing you with comfort and peace of mind for years to come.
